Axis-stressed double-angle-steel combined T-shaped section reinforcing structure
The invention discloses an axis stress double-angle steel combined T-shaped section reinforcing structure which comprises two groups of reinforced members, the end parts of the two groups of reinforced members are connected with gusset plates, the middle parts of the two groups of reinforced members are connected with filling plates in a welding manner, the reinforced members are mutually spliced with a first reinforcing member, and the first reinforcing member is connected with a second reinforcing member in a welding manner. The reinforced part and the first reinforcing part are connected and fixed through intermittent welding seams, and fixing plates are connected to the reinforced part in an up-down symmetry mode. The reinforced pieces are made of angle steel, and the section of the combination of the two reinforced pieces is of a T-shaped structure. According to the axis-stressed double-angle-steel combined T-shaped section reinforcing structure, the two sets of first reinforcing pieces which are in bilateral symmetry are adopted, it can be guaranteed that the whole rod piece is evenly stressed, and therefore the bearing capacity of the whole rod piece is effectively improved, the centroids of the rod piece are basically kept consistent before and after reinforcing, the bearing capacity of the rod piece can be remarkably improved, and through two examples, the structure is simple and convenient to operate. Therefore, the bearing capacity of the structure can be improved by more than 70%.
